Job Details

The post is based in Westminster, liaising with staff in the constituency. Organisational and policy/research skills plus use of communications/social media is essential. Experience in welfare/finance policy and knowledge of High Peak is desirable.

You must be effective/professional at all times, with a desire to be part of a team dedicated to ensuring effective action in Westminster for High Peak.

Key Tasks

  • Administrative support, including correspondence/enquiries in Parliament and liaising with the constituency office as required.
  • Manage the London diary, including provision of real time updates from the House, relevant Committees and/or Whips to Ruth.
  • Develop/maintain knowledge of bills, Early Day Motions, legislation, Hansard, debates and other Parliamentary business.
  • Monitor media coverage and brief Ruth on relevant issues.
  • Prepare/present briefing notes for committees, press releases, parliamentary questions, speeches and other output for the Member.
  • Analyse, evaluate and interpret data (from Parliament and external stakeholders where required) to ensure Ruth is accurately informed on key issues, including in respect of potential questions and motions to be put to the House.
  • Assist with casework and campaigns as required.
  • Manage and contribute to policy projects which the Member chooses to lead on.
  • Supervise other staff/volunteers/interns) as appropriate.
